I've stopped using DVD-R/CD-R's long ago... it's actually cheaper per GB to just get an external USB enclosure and a big fat hard drive.
(it also helps to have an old Linux box nearby jammed solid with disks configured in RAID 5 and running Bacula... ) I figure between the two additional copies, I'm set ...at least until I can grab hold of an LTO-3 tape drive (800GB compressed per tape) and a couple of blank tapes.
(then again, even an old DLT IV drive would work at this point (80GB compressed per tape), and would actually be cheap enough media-wise to be practical).
